The term "wrought iron" is widely used in the trade as a general descriptor for ornamental ironwork, though most modern components are fabricated from mild steel, which is stronger and more workable than true historical wrought iron. Cast iron is used for decorative elements such as collars, base shoes, spears, finials, balls, and rosettes where complex shapes are needed. Superior Ornamental Supply's ornamental iron products follow this industry-standard use of the term.
